*{box-sizing:border-box}footer{font-size:clamp(1vh,.7vw,1rem);font-style:italic}html,body,#root{color:#fff;background-color:#111827;max-width:100%;margin:0;font-family:Inter,sans-serif;overflow-x:hidden}a{text-decoration:none}.header{background-color:#020617;width:100%;padding-bottom:2vh}.header-content{flex-direction:column;justify-content:center;align-items:center;display:flex}.header-title{display:flex}.landscaping-logo{fill:#fff;width:5vw;height:5vw;margin-top:1.5vh;margin-left:2vh}h1{white-space:nowrap;text-align:center;font-size:clamp(3vh,3vw,3.3rem)}h2,h3{color:#d1d5db;text-align:center}h2{font-size:clamp(.9rem,1.6vw,1.6rem)}h3{font-size:clamp(1.7vh,1.4vw,1.4rem)}.underline{background-color:#fffdfd8c;width:50%;height:.1rem}.navbar{justify-content:center;align-items:center;margin-top:.3rem;display:flex}.navbar-buttons{color:#ffffff93;border-radius:10px;margin:0 clamp(.1rem,4vw,5rem);padding:.2rem .5rem;font-size:clamp(.7rem,1vw,1.6rem);text-decoration:none;transition:all .25s}.navbar-buttons:hover{color:#fff;background-color:#ffffff36}.ironworks-button{border-radius:10px;flex-direction:column;align-items:center;display:flex}.ironworks-button:hover .navbar-buttons,.ironworks-button:hover .anvil-hammer{color:#fff;background-color:#ffffff15}.ironworks-button:hover{background-color:#16000000}.anvil-hammer{border-radius:5px;width:4vw;transition:all .25s}.home{margin-top:6vh}.image-slide-container{border-radius:50%;flex-direction:column;align-items:center;width:100%;margin-bottom:5vh;padding:0;display:flex}.image-slide-title{cursor:pointer;background-color:#020617;border-top-left-radius:15px;border-top-right-radius:15px;margin:0;padding:1.3rem 1.3rem .5rem}.image-slide{cursor:pointer;border:.6rem solid #020617;border-top-width:1.4rem;border-radius:20px;width:90%;position:relative;overflow:hidden}.image-slide-container:hover .image-slide-title,.image-slide-container:hover .image-slide{color:#fff;background-color:#03071d;border-color:#03071d}.track{width:max-content;animation:30s linear infinite scroll;display:flex}.slide-img{object-fit:cover;border-radius:5px;flex-shrink:0;width:20vw;height:40vh;margin-right:.5rem}@keyframes scroll{0%{transform:translate(0)}to{transform:translate(-50%)}}.about{color:#d1d5db;margin-top:50px}.about-body,.about-points{text-align:center;font-size:.9vw}.portrait-left,.portrait-right{object-fit:cover;border-radius:10px;width:20vw;height:23vw;margin:0 20px}.portrait-right{float:right}.portrait-left{float:left}.backdrop{z-index:1000;background-color:#0000008f;width:100vw;height:100vh;position:fixed;top:0;left:0}.selected-image{object-fit:contain;z-index:1000;width:auto;max-width:90vw;height:auto;max-height:90vh;position:fixed;top:50%;left:50%;transform:translate(-50%,-50%)}.contact{background-color:#0b1220;flex-direction:column;align-items:center;margin-top:3rem;display:flex}.contact-info-container{gap:1rem;margin-top:1vw;margin-bottom:2vw;display:flex}.contact p,.contact a{color:#f0f8ffb2;text-align:center;font-size:clamp(1.4vh,.8vw,1rem)}.contact a{color:#00f}.licenses{gap:40px;margin-bottom:10px;display:flex}.license{fill:#fff;width:max(6vh,4vw);height:max(6vh,4vw)}.gallery-img-container{flex-wrap:wrap;justify-content:center;gap:16px;margin-bottom:100px;display:flex}.gallery-img{object-fit:cover;border-radius:5px;width:20vw;height:17vw;transition:transform .2s}.gallery-img:hover{transform:scale(1.03)}.landscaping-title-container{justify-content:center;align-items:center;gap:clamp(.9rem,5vw,1.6rem);margin-top:3vh;margin-bottom:3vh;display:flex}.back-button,.spacer-button{fill:#ffffffbf;border-radius:10px;width:2vw;height:2vw;transition:all .2s}.back-button{cursor:pointer}.back-button:hover{background-color:#ffffff1b}.spacer-button{opacity:0}.category-title{margin:0}@media (orientation:portrait){.underline{width:90%}.anvil-hammer{width:6vh}.landscaping-logo{width:6vh;height:6vh}.slide-img{width:20vh;height:20vh}.portrait-left,.portrait-right{float:none;margin-left:14vw;margin-right:14vw}.about-body,.about-points{font-size:1.3vh}.gallery-img{width:20vh;height:15vh}.back-button,.spacer-button{width:4vh;height:4vh}}
